cpu/hotplug: Get rid of CPU_STARTING reference

CPU_STARTING is scheduled for removal. There is no use of it in drivers
and core code uses it only for compatibility with old-style CPU-hotplug
notifiers.  This patch removes therefore removes CPU_STARTING from an
RCU-related comment.
